[摘要]闡述了加強(qiáng)節(jié)點(diǎn)型裝配式高層鋼框架的結(jié)構(gòu)形式。通過與剛性節(jié)點(diǎn)框架及中心支撐鋼框架進(jìn)行對(duì)比研究,揭示了該結(jié)構(gòu)體系的受力與變形特點(diǎn),介紹了該結(jié)構(gòu)體系的抗震性能。通過典型項(xiàng)目說明了該結(jié)構(gòu)體系工廠化水平及安裝效率。
[關(guān)鍵詞]斜支撐; 裝配式高層鋼結(jié)構(gòu); 加強(qiáng)型節(jié)點(diǎn); 節(jié)點(diǎn)特性; 安裝效率; 工廠化

Abstract: The forms of the high-rise prefabricated steel frame structure of strengthening node were described. Through a comparative study of the steel frame structure and concentrically braced frame structure system, characterstics of force and deformation are revealed. The seismic performance of this structure system is introduced. Through the typical project the factory-made structure system and the installation efficiency are highlighted.
Keywords: bracing; prefabricated high-rise steel structure; strengthening node; node characteristic; installation efficiency; factory-made
